Kohima, May 9 (MExN): The Makers Market is currently underway at Bstudio, Artisan Loft, located in the main town commercial complex, Kohima. Running from May 8 to 10, the event is open daily from 12 PM to 5 PM.

This three-day event celebrates art, creativity, and mindful making, offering a curated platform for organically handmade products that reflect sustainable practices and local craftsmanship. The market fosters a supportive space where creativity, community, and conscious living come together.

Organised by Bstudio boutique in support of the Vocal for Local initiative, the Makers Market shines a spotlight on locally handmade items. It is hosted at Artisan Loft—a venue where creativity meets community, providing the perfect backdrop for this meaningful gathering.

The market features 11 women entrepreneurs, each showcasing a range of handcrafted goods, original artwork, and home-baked treats. Visitors have the chance to connect directly with makers, support small local businesses, and experience the richness of indigenous talent.
